Avoid background noise. Whether you have music playing in your office, or you’re sitting in a coffee shop, background noise can make it difficult for your customers to understand your greeting. Limit the noise around you when you leave your voicemail greeting.

Change your voicemail password: Go to Settings > Phone > Change Voicemail Password, then enter the new password.
